Why Gut Health Is Central to Whole-Body Wellness

Modern lifestyles place immense strain on the digestive system. Highly processed foods, chronic stress, poor sleep, medication use, and environmental toxins all contribute to gut imbalance. Over time, this can lead to inflammation, digestive discomfort, fatigue, weakened immunity, brain fog, and mood disturbances.


Scientific research increasingly confirms that the gut microbiome—home to trillions of microorganisms—plays a critical role in regulating inflammation, immune responses, hormone balance, and even mental health. When the gut is supported, the body is better equipped to heal, recover, and maintain balance.



Understanding the Microbiome and Its Role in Health

The microbiome refers to the diverse ecosystem of bacteria, yeasts, and microorganisms living primarily in the gut. A healthy, diverse microbiome supports digestion, nutrient absorption, immune defence, and communication between the gut and the brain. When diversity is reduced or harmful bacteria dominate, inflammation and dysfunction often follow.

The Gut–Brain Connection

The gut and brain are in constant communication through what is known as the gut–brain axis. Imbalances in gut health can influence mood, stress response, sleep quality, and mental clarity. Likewise, emotional stress and unresolved tension can negatively impact digestion and microbiome balance.
